Output 841510b31c4502fcd2999be52226029a72dfb6771427d639324dac629e252114:93

value
66610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d8483dc6c0b5cb69f5af5a52dc1ed71ba128898 OP_EQUAL
address
35qh5V7HXnY2cSvCPWgt4NKXTQpxsgdvJY
transaction
841510b31c4502fcd2999be52226029a72dfb6771427d639324dac629e252114